I'm looking for advice apartment door entry systems. Currently there is an old handset system in a building, using telephone wire, although it doesn't work thanks to I suspect a sparky not reconnecting it when he moved a consumer unit. But the physical wiring from the old buzzer system to the apartments looks fine (I'll check it all before I order anything, and replace wiring if it isn't ok)

I would prefer to upgrade it to a video based system, and going through various lock/system suppliers, seem to mostly list Chinese made units, and with poor documentation and not doubt dubious support, I'm not really sold on them. I found a 10 year old thread and someone said they use (Came) BPT systems for commercial installs. So I have been going over their product range and they seems you can mix and match to build a system for your needs. I like they have a video monitor that can connect to wifi and allow to be controlled via smartphones, when the other chinese systems required an IP Gateway, which hasn't been released. Plus the BPT system can be optioned with RFID on the Entry Panel, something else is a nice to have.

Has anyone got experience and advice? Or any other systems worth looking at?

I put systems with colour video by Bell. Used them in flats and an HMO for adults with learning difficulties. Never had any issues with any of them.

Offer usual door entry options including a mute function. Handy if the local drunks like pressing the call buttons.
